In regents of the university of california v. bakke (1978), the supreme court determined that __________ were unconstitutional.
Amanda [17]
I believe the correct answer is the first option. In regents of the university of california v. bakke (1978), the supreme court determined that racial quotas in university were unconstitutional. It was a landmark decision that was made by the Supreme Court. It did not allowed race to be one of the factors in admission to colleges.

What is the name of the following atoms? An atom with 3 protons and 4 neutrons: *
Masteriza [31]

Answer:

A lithium atom contains 3 protons in its nucleus. Notice that because the lithium atom always has 3 protons, the atomic number for lithium is always Z = 3. The mass number, however, is A = 6 for the isotope with 3 neutrons, and A = 7 for the isotope with 4 neutrons.
